Nawazuddin Siddiqui, a Bollywood celebrity, has said that he will no longer work on projects aimed at India’s growing streaming market, describing online platforms as a “dumping ground for redundant shows.”

Nawazuddin Siddiqui, a well-known actor, starred in Netflix’s first Indian original series, Sacred Games, which premiered to critical acclaim in 2018.

However, in an interview published over the weekend on Bollywood Hungama, the 47-year-old said that “quantity has killed quality” on so-called over-the-top (OTT) web platforms.
